Stuck at 2.4MBytes/s
I am running SABNZBD 2.3.9 on Windows 10. After a reboot, the throughput is fine (30MBytes/s). The longer my W10 desktop stays up the greater the degradation in speeds.
Any ideas as to why this might be happening?
